According to Saednews political news report, a question that often arises is what gifts politicians and prominent figures receive on their birthdays. October 7 marks the birthday of Vladimir Putin. This report shows the types of gifts the President of Russia has received during his time in office to mark his birthday.

Siberian Tiger Cub Named “Masha”

Ten years ago, in 2008, an unidentified person—reportedly a journalist for a news magazine—presented Putin with a tiger cub as a birthday gift.

Crystal Crocodile

Putin traveled to Moldova, the host country of a Commonwealth of Independent States summit, to attend a meeting of its leaders. There, Moldovan President Vladimir Voronin gave him a crystal crocodile as a gift for his 50th birthday.

Victory Sword

The “Victory Sword” was a gift Putin received from the King of Bahrain. It featured a Damascus steel blade with a handle made of precious metals and stones. Additionally, Indonesian President Joko Widodo visited Bocharov Ruchey, the Russian president’s summer residence, and staged a ceremonial dagger performance for him.

Dogs

Dogs are among Putin’s favorite animals, and he has received them as gifts multiple times. The President of Japan gifted him an Akita Inu, while he also received a dog from the President of Bulgaria and an Alabai from the President of Turkmenistan.

Books: The Best Gift for Putin

On Vladimir Putin’s 60th birthday, Dmitry Medvedev presented him with the first edition of Tsarskoye Selo by renowned historian Alexander Benois.

Bedspread

Former Italian Prime Minister Silvio Berlusconi gifted him a handmade bedspread featuring embroidered images of St. Basil’s Cathedral and the Colosseum.

Accordion

Former Argentine President Cristina Fernández de Kirchner gave him an accordion as a symbol of friendship and strong relations between the two countries.
